Mundra Port IPO subscribed over 7 times The initial public offer (IPO) of Adani group-promoted Mundra Port and Special Economic Zone Ltd (MPSEZL) on Monday got subscribed over seven times on the third day of the issue. The issue received bids for 30.01 crore shares against the 4.02 crore shares on offer, latest data available on the exchanges show. The price band for the issue has been fixed between Rs 400 to Rs 440. The offer would close on November 7. MPSEZL is the first company from SEZ and port sector to hit the capital market. The Internet Protocol Television Service, or IPTV, has been on the drawing board for over three years at Reliance Communications, but the commercial launch is still a few months away. IPTV is one of the most talked about projects at Reliance Communications. It had signed up with Microsoft for this three years ago, but consumers must wait at least until next year to sample the product. Reliance Communications claims the commercial launch in Mumbai and Delhi will take place before this financial year is out.
